Nel mondo dei videogiochi online e delle applicazioni interattive, la precisione nel controllo e nelle interazioni è fondamentale. Uno degli aspetti più della discussione riguarda l’uso efficiente dei controlli da tastiera, in particolare i tasti di controllo come la barra spaziatrice.
Introduzione: L’importanza dei controlli di gioco e interfaccia utente
Nell’ecosistema del gaming browser-based, la capacità di personalizzare le modalità di input degli utenti rappresenta un elemento cruciale per migliorare l’esperienza di gioco e l’accessibilità. La barra spaziatrice, in particolare, tradizionalmente associata a comandi come il salto o la pausa, può essere attivata o disattivata in modo da adattarsi alle esigenze di giocatori con diverse capacità o preferenze di controllo.
Controlli da tastiera: Un elemento chiave dell’esperienza utente
Molti giochi web e applicazioni interattive richiedono input rapidi e precisi. La gestione di questi input si traduce in:
- Reattività: Essenzialità di risposte immediate alle azioni dell’utente.
- Accessibilità: Favorire tutti i tipi di utenti, inclusi quelli con disabilità motorie o visive.
- Personalizzazione: La possibilità di configurare i controlli in modo ottimale per ogni giocatore.
Case study: La personalizzazione dei controlli
Una delle sfide principali è garantire che i controlli siano intuitivi e facilmente personalizzabili. Per esempio, un giocatore potrebbe preferire assegnare azioni diverse alla barra spaziatrice, come il salto, o potrebbe volerla disabilitare temporaneamente per evitare input accidentali. Supportare questa personalizzazione richiede lo sviluppo di strumenti affidabili, quali impostazioni dedicate, e una gestione robusta degli eventi input.
Analisi tecnica: Come abilitare o disabilitare la barra spaziatrice al gioco
Per esempio, nell’implementazione di giochi in JavaScript, utilizzare eventi come keydown e keyup consente di monitorare i tasti premuti. La disattivazione temporanea può essere raggiunta invalidando gli eventi oppure bloccando l’azione di default del browser.
Un esempio pratico:
// Evento di controllo personalizzato
document.addEventListener('keydown', function(event) {
if (event.key === ' ' && controlloSpazioDisabilitato) {
event.preventDefault();
}
});
Rivoluzione con https://chickenroad2-gratis.it/
Per i gamer e gli sviluppatori che desiderano approfondire come how to enable space bar controls nel contesto di giochi più complessi o applicazioni interattive, questa piattaforma offre tutorali e strumenti dedicati.
In particolare, chi sviluppa giochi può trarre beneficio dall’analisi di soluzioni avanzate di gestione degli input, garantendo che gli utenti possano attivare o disattivare i controlli da tastiera in modo user-friendly e senza compromettere la stabilità del gioco o dell’app.
Il ruolo della gestione degli eventi negli ambienti di sviluppo moderni
Utilizzare strumenti come Web Workers, API di accessibilità e framework di input garantisce un’esperienza più fluida e personalizzabile. La sfida consiste nel bilanciare la reattività con la personalizzazione, particolarmente in giochi competitivo o di alta complessità.
Approfondimenti e best practice
| Fase | Strategia | Esempio |
|---|---|---|
| Ascolto eventi | Implementare via addEventListener |
Controllo a livello globale |
| Gestione stati | Attivare/disattivare gli script in base alla modalità | Abilita/disabilita spazio in modo dinamico |
| Personalizzazione | Interfacce utente intuitive | Selezione nel menu delle impostazioni |
Conclusione: L’equilibrio tra controllo e libertà di gioco
In definitiva, l’abilitazione o la disattivazione dei controlli da tastiera, come la barra spaziatrice, rappresenta una componente essenziale per un design di interfaccia efficace. Grazie a strumenti e metodologie avanzate, gli sviluppatori possono offrire un’esperienza personalizzata e inclusiva, rafforzando la credibilità e la professionalità del proprio prodotto e garantendo pratiche di accessibilità ottimali. Per approfondimenti su come personalizzare questa funzione, si può consultare direttamente la risorsa offerta da How to enable space bar controls, un riferimento autorevole nel settore.
Note: L’implementazione e gestione corretta dei controlli da tastiera consente di migliorare la soddisfazione degli utenti e di conformarsi agli standard di accessibilità, elemento imprescindibile per il successo di qualsiasi applicazione web moderna.
